
I took a slightly longer walk over lunch today, to a place called The Scone Witch. I'd read about it in
CheapEats Ottawa, and a friend had recently mentioned it to me too. A quirky little house surrounded by tall and severe glass offices - it looked a little out of place. But it was warm and toasty inside, with an open kitchen where diners could see and smell the different scones being prepared.

I ordered a Mealwich of feta scone with Mediterranean vegetables, caramelised onions and goat cheese. It came with a side of freshly tossed salad in orange balsamic vinegar dressing. It was really good! The scone essentially served as the "bread" for the "sandwich", and was the right balance of moist and crisp. It was very buttery, yet light. Yums :-) I have never tried baking scones - I guess I will now!
Scone Witch is a great place to hang out with a cup of tea and a good book. I'm eyeing their weekend brunch as well, which looked like a steal at $10.50. I'll be back!! ;-)
